Ajax is no longer an experimental approach to website development, but the key to building browser-based applications that form the cornerstone of Web 2.0. "Head First Ajax" gives you an up-to-date perspective that lets you see exactly what you can do - and has been done - with Ajax. With it, you get a highly practical, in-depth, and mature view of what is now a mature development approach. Using the unique and highly effective visual format that has turned "Head First" titles into runaway bestsellers, this book offers a big picture overview to introduce Ajax, and then explores the use of individual Ajax components - including the JavaScript event model, DOM, XML, JSON, and more - as it progresses.You'll find plenty of sample applications that illustrate the concepts, along with exercises, quizzes, and other interactive features to help you retain what you've learned. "Head First Ajax" covers: the JavaScript event model; making Ajax requests with XML HTTP REQUEST objects; the asynchronous application model; the Document Object Model (DOM); manipulating the DOM in JavaScript; controlling the browser with the Browser Object Model; XHTML Forms; POST Requests; XML Syntax and the XML DOM tree; XML Requests & Responses; JSON - an alternative to XML; Ajax architecture & patterns; and the Prototype Library.The book also discusses the server-side implications of building Ajax applications, and uses a "black box" approach to server-side components. "Head First Ajax" is the ideal guide for experienced web developers comfortable with scripting - particularly those who have completed the exercises in "Head First JavaScript" - and for experienced programmers in Java, PHP, and C# who want to learn client-side programming.
很不错,入门级,强调基本概念,强调每个技术细节的作用,这样的书让人读起来比较舒服,也比较有成就感,当然如果深入研究的话,还需要再看其他的书,但是作为入门,这本书还是很赞的。
评分很不错,入门级,强调基本概念,强调每个技术细节的作用,这样的书让人读起来比较舒服,也比较有成就感,当然如果深入研究的话,还需要再看其他的书,但是作为入门,这本书还是很赞的。
评分Head 的书一贯是比较浅显易懂的,看这样的影印书真有感觉是在学习程序。对于程序这个非中国人发明的东西,还是看原版的比较过瘾。 就本书而言,比较薄,没有其他的语言的厚实感。内容上看也有点淡薄。如果现在你用Ajax是针对PHP的,那么这算是一本不错的书,但是你用的是其他的...
评分很不错,入门级,强调基本概念,强调每个技术细节的作用,这样的书让人读起来比较舒服,也比较有成就感,当然如果深入研究的话,还需要再看其他的书,但是作为入门,这本书还是很赞的。
评分Head 的书一贯是比较浅显易懂的,看这样的影印书真有感觉是在学习程序。对于程序这个非中国人发明的东西,还是看原版的比较过瘾。 就本书而言,比较薄,没有其他的语言的厚实感。内容上看也有点淡薄。如果现在你用Ajax是针对PHP的,那么这算是一本不错的书,但是你用的是其他的...
这本书在技术深度的把握上达到了一个极高的平衡点。它既没有停留在浅尝辄止的“Hello World”层面,也没有一头扎进晦涩难懂的底层协议细节中。作者非常聪明地选择了一个非常实用的切入点——聚焦于如何构建响应迅速、用户体验卓越的Web应用。对于Ajax这个核心概念,它的讲解逻辑非常严密,从最初的`XMLHttpRequest`对象的基本用法,到如何处理不同浏览器间的兼容性问题,再到异步数据交互的错误处理和超时设置,每一步都处理得面面俱到。更难能可贵的是,它没有固步自封于旧技术,而是很快地将读者的视野引向了更现代的异步处理模式。它教你如何用更健壮、更易于维护的方式来组织你的网络请求逻辑,这对于任何想要从“能用”迈向“好用”的开发者来说,都是至关重要的宝贵经验。阅读完相关章节后,我立刻尝试重构了公司项目中一个饱受诟病的旧模块,效率和稳定性都有了肉眼可见的提升,这种即时反馈的效能,是衡量一本技术书价值的硬性标准。
评分这本书的排版设计简直是一场视觉盛宴,完全颠覆了我对传统技术书籍的刻板印象。它不是那种冷冰冰的代码堆砌,而是充满了鲜活的插图、幽默的对话框和清晰的流程图。每次翻开它,都感觉像是在和一个经验丰富、又非常风趣的导师面对面交流。作者似乎深谙“寓教于乐”的精髓,他们用各种精心设计的场景和比喻,把那些原本枯燥乏味的异步加载原理讲得活灵活现。我尤其欣赏它对概念的拆解方式,不是一股脑地灌输,而是通过一系列层层递进的小挑战和“思考时间”,引导你去主动构建知识体系。这使得学习过程充满了探索的乐趣,而不是被动的接受。我记得有一次,我在理解某个回调地狱(Callback Hell)的解决方案时感到困惑,但书中通过一个漫画故事,完美地展示了Promise链式调用的优雅,那一瞬间的“顿悟感”是其他书籍难以给予的。这本书的插图不仅仅是装饰,它们是信息的载体,很多时候,一张图胜过千言万语的解释,极大地降低了技术学习的门槛,让初学者也能迅速抓住核心要点,不会被厚重的理论吓跑。
评分我是一个习惯于动手实践的学习者,很多技术书籍的理论部分我读起来非常吃力,但这本书的实践环节设计得极其人性化。它不像某些教程那样,要求你搭建一个庞大的开发环境,而是提供了一系列可以立即在浏览器中运行的小例子。代码片段被切割得非常精巧,每一个小的代码块都有明确的目的性,并且紧跟着对这段代码工作原理的详细剖析。更棒的是,它鼓励你“破坏”代码,看看会发生什么。通过修改参数、故意引入错误,来亲身体验不同配置对结果的影响,这种主动探索带来的知识记忆是深刻且持久的。我发现,书中对构建过程的描述非常细致,即便是涉及到跨域请求(CORS)这种初学者容易迷糊的环节,也是通过清晰的请求-响应流程图来讲解,让人彻底搞明白“浏览器”和“服务器”之间到底发生了什么。这种“边学边做,即时反馈”的学习闭环,极大地提高了我的学习效率和自信心。
评分作为一本侧重于前端交互技术的书籍,这本书对性能优化和用户体验的关注度令人印象深刻。它没有仅仅满足于让数据加载成功,而是深入探讨了如何让加载过程“感觉更顺畅”。书中对加载指示器(Loading Indicators)的设计、渐进式增强(Progressive Enhancement)的理念,都有非常深入且实用的讨论。我特别喜欢它关于“感知性能”的部分,它提醒我们,即使后台请求耗时较长,通过良好的前端反馈设计,也能极大地提升用户满意度。它教会我如何利用空白区域、骨架屏(Skeleton Screens)等技术,来“欺骗”用户的等待时间,使应用在实际速度不变的情况下,体验上得到质的飞跃。这已经超出了单纯的技术实现范畴,触及到了产品设计和用户心理学的层面。这本书不仅让我成为了一个更合格的工程师,更让我成为了一个更懂得站在用户角度思考问题的开发者,这是我从其他纯粹的代码手册中学不到的宝贵财富。
评分这本书的叙事风格非常独特,它成功地将技术教学融入了一种轻松、甚至有点“不正经”的对话氛围中。作者似乎完全没有架子,他们不是高高在上的专家,而是更像是几个和你一起并肩作战的伙伴。你会看到很多拟人化的比喻,比如把网络请求比作送信,把数据格式比作不同语言的信件。这种拟人化处理,极大地消解了技术术语的距离感,使得复杂的概念也变得亲切起来。我最欣赏的是,它在讲解概念时,总会穿插一些关于“为什么”的讨论,而不是仅仅停留在“怎么做”。比如,它会探讨为什么我们需要异步,异步带来的挑战是什么,而不是直接抛出解决方案。这种对底层动机的挖掘,使得我不仅仅学会了工具的使用,更重要的是理解了背后的设计哲学。这种“软性”的知识渗透,让我的技术思维得到了升华,不再是机械地复制粘贴代码,而是能够根据实际场景,设计出更合理的解决方案。
评分真正的深入浅出AJAX,除了讲述AJAX知识外,也讲述了前端的一些基础知识。很适合刚刚入门的js
评分非常基础的Ajax知识,其中大量的解释了browser之间的区别和实现技术细节,但那些可以使用jQuery轻松忽略的,所以建议跳过此书直接进入读 Head first jQuery
评分故事讲解类型的,废话一大堆,适合给什么都不懂的+喜欢看故事的新人看。但是绝对不适合都已经懂了的想进阶的人看
评分ajax经典著作
评分全文讀完減一星,後面四、五章的知識雖然必要,但放在寫AJAX的書裏有濫竽充數之嫌。 // 讀了一半,還算是按計劃行事。每章一個實用的例子,學起來實在是受益匪淺!另外,全書不單單講XMLHttpRequest,而是從廣義上來講解Ajax,贊! // 多次尝试之后走上了学习Ajax的正道,按照一天一章的进度,两周内应该可以拿下,学习时心情大好。
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有